Macy's Stock Hits 1-Year Low After Mixed Results
Retail stock Macy's Inc (NYSE:M) is down 1.9% at 13.05, earlier hitting a 52-week low of $12.60. The company reported mixed fourth-quarter results, including better-than-expected earnings alongside a revenue miss, but investors are focusing in on the disappointing full-year guidance. Notably, CEO Tony Spring's turnaround efforts appear to be taking shape, however, with comparable sales up 0.2% -- the highest since the first quarter of 2022.
